This role is in support of Cencora's wholesale distribution services in Europe operating through our Alliance Healthcare business. Alliance Healthcare Leeds are looking for an experienced Team Leader who will be responsible for the Inbound department directing all operatives to ensure an efficient process is in line with budgeted targets.
Location: LS11 0LR
Working Days: Monday to Friday
Hours and shift times: 39 hours per week 1400 - 2200
Rate of Pay: £13.72 per hour
Key responsibilities:
- Ensure that agreed productivity rates are achieved and labour costs fall within agreed targets, relating to the number of SKUs and lines processed
- Use IT, Knapp, and manual aids to monitor staff performance in areas of productivity and accuracy in relation to agreed targets in SKU and line movement
- Assist the management team within the disciplinary process by completing investigations or taking minutes when required
- Ensure damages are kept below the agreed levels (aiming for no damaged stock)
- Ensure missing orders/stock are kept within agreed targets
- Responsible for the organisation of staff and ensure they maintain the agreed level of performance throughout the shift
- Ensure all return to work forms are completed within the correct time scale
- Follow fully with H&S regulations and ensure all staff comply
- Ensure all 1-2-1's are completed within the agreed time scale
- Attend training and develop relevant knowledge and skills

Operating Standards:
- Liaise with other team members within the site to ensure smooth work flow through the warehouse
- Ensure all staff keep their areas of responsibility of housekeeping to the agreed standards at all times
- Ensure all stock/returns have been put away to the correct location each day
- Ensure all documentation is presented to each manager on completion of the shift
- Responsible for completion of team sheets
Communication:
- Ensuring leadership and motivation is given through regular daily and weekly team brief to staff
- Ensuring routine and regular liaison with fellow team leaders
Training and Development:
- Effectively carrying out training and development of all staff
